How can I avoid trouble?

God’s Response

If you keep your mouth shut, you will stay out of trouble. Proverbs 21:23

Blessed are those who have a tender conscience, but the stubborn are headed for serious trouble. Proverbs 28:14

The trustworthy will get a rich reward. But the person who wants to get rich quick will only get into trouble. Proverbs 28:20

I have told you all this so that you may have peace in me. Here on earth you will have many trials and sorrows. But take heart, because I have overcome the world. John 16:33

There are two kinds of trouble—trouble that you cause because of a mistake, a bad decision, or an act of sin, and trouble that invades your life through no fault of your own. The first kind of trouble can usually be avoided through good planning and godly living. The second kind of trouble cannot usually be avoided, but God promises to help us through it and to eliminate it forever one day. You won’t always be able to avoid trouble, but you can keep from looking for it!

God’s Promise

The power of the life-giving Spirit has freed you through Christ Jesus from the power of sin that leads to death. Romans 8:2
